Petition Calls for Barack Obama to Run as French President


obama posters.PNG
Obama 17 posters are seen displayed on Feb. 23, 2017 in Paris, France 


In France, a petition is calling to add former US President, Barack Obama as one the candidates in the upcoming French election.

The Obama 17 campaign, which was launched earlier this week, is attempting to collect 1 million signatures by March 15 in order to persuade Obama to stand in the May election. 

Barack Obama has the best resume in the world for the job," the site explains. "Because at a time when France is about to vote massively for the extreme right, we can still give a lesson of democracy to the planet by electing a French President, a foreigner."

NBC Reports that posters calling for Obama 2017 have been plastered around Paris and the petition has received about 27,000 signatures so far. One of the site's founders told NBC that he thought up the idea for the campaign with four friends "after a drink."

The 5 people vying for the French presidency in 2017 include: Emmanuel Macron, Marine Le Pen, Benôit Hamon, Jean-Luc Melenchon, François Fillon
